Acceptance rate & Admissions

Acceptance Rate31%
Admissions RequirementsGraduation from high school and entrance examination. Special provisions for foreign students with similar qualifications
Academic CalendarApril to March (April - September; October-March)

We've calculated the 31% acceptance rate for Tokyo University of Pharmacy and Life Science based on the ratio of admissions to applications and other circumstantial enrollment data. Treat this information as a rough guide and not as a definitive measure of your chances of admission. Different programs may have significantly varying admissions rates.

Research profile

Tokyo University of Pharmacy and Life Science has published 8,044 scientific papers with 179,399 citations received. The research profile covers a range of fields, including Biology, Chemistry, Biochemistry, Genetics, Medicine, Organic Chemistry, Physics, Engineering, Environmental Science, and Materials Science.
